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was utilized in many different applications until the 1970s. At that point asbestos's dangers exposure were well-known and it was largely banned. It is still present in some consumer products and industrial structures.

New York State has its own asbestos laws and regulations, as well as the Environmental Protection Agency. These laws promote safe handling and removal asbestos-containing materials. The NYC Asbestos Law also requires companies involved in asbestos abatement to follow NYSDEC guidelines.

A New York asbestos lawyer will know how to file a suit to ensure that victims and their families, receive most compensation. They will also be aware of the specifics of the statutes of limitations. For example, personal injury and wrongful death claims must be filed within three years of the mesothelioma diagnosis, or two years following the death of the victim.

New York is a hotbed of asbestos litigation due to the high rate of exposure. The courts are aware of these cases and have streamlined the procedure. For instance, judges accelerate trials for terminally ill plaintiffs and they group similar cases together to make it easier to examine evidence.
